IXTQ42N25PDisc Mosfet N-CH Std-Polar TO-3P (3) | FETs, MOSFETs | 1 | Active | Polar™ Standard Power MOSFETs are tailored to provide designers with a device solution that offers the best compromise between performance and cost. These devices incorporate the Polar technology platform to achieve low on-state resistances (Rdson). Polar Standard MOSFETs feature low gate charge Qg values, resulting in more efficient switching at all frequencies. This gives the designer the option to operate at higher frequencies, which enables the use of smaller passive components in a variety of load switching designs. The avalanche capabilities of these devices add an additional safeguard against over-voltage transients. Advantages: Easy to mount Space savings High power density |

IXTQ86N20TDiscMSFT NChTrenchGate-Gen1 TO-3P (3) | Single FETs, MOSFETs | 1 | Active | Trench Gate Power MOSFETs are ideally suited for low voltage/ high current applications, requiring an exceedingly low RDS(on), thus guaranteeing very low power Dissipation. This, combined with wide ranging operating junction temperature from -40 °C to 175 °C make them suitable candidates for automobile applications and other similar demanding applications in harsh environments. Advantages: Easy to Mount Space Savings High power density |
